Playing-related musculoskeletal disorders in drummers
Štorek, Jan ; Pánek, David (advisor) ; Pavlů, Dagmar (referee)
Title: Playing-related musculoskeletal disorders in drummers Objectives: The aim of this study is to collect literature resources focusing on the field of performing arts medicine in musicians with a special focus on drummers. The main focus will be directed on the therapeutic, preventive, educational and ergonomic influence of musculoskeletal disabilities. Methods: This is a literature review, written mainly from foreign sources in English. Electronic databases like Pubmed, Pedro, Science Direct, Springer and Wiley were used. Special attention was given to studies that describe health problems of musicians associated with playing drums. Instrument ergonomics, prevention and education in this field is also described. Results: 128 studies corresponded to the entry criteria. 88 of these studies were devoted to health problems of playing a musical instrument in general, 5 studies were directly addressing particular health risks associated with playing drums. Another 11 studies were describing percussionists within a larger sample of musicians. Conclusion: There are not many studies dealing with health issues associated with playing the drums. European specifics of the art of percussion instruments: Basics of natural playing
Zhdanovich, Anton ; MIKOLÁŠEK, Daniel (advisor) ; Holub, Petr (referee)
This work is a summary of the information and knowledge about the basics that make up the present tradition of playing percussion instruments in Europe (predominantly Western). Its main purpose is to support the development of percussion instruments in Czech Republic, especially in schools, where the playing level is in the development stage and needs to be supported from other sources. During my Master's study at HAMU (2014-2017), I took part in many of international events in this field, which were focused on the development of young musicians of my generation on musical, technical, mental and aesthetic side. The obtained information by feedbacks and comments from leading teachers and performers in the field is the absolute basis for this work. Awareness of the principles and basics that will be written here requires a presence of certain musical and life experiences, so this work is intended for the age category from the students of secondary vocational schools and above.
The development of interpretational demands on Czech composers works for percussion instruments from the 1960s to the present
Veselý, Šimon ; MIKOLÁŠEK, Daniel (advisor) ; BARTOŇ, Hanuš (referee)
This diploma thesis deals with the growing tendency of composers of Czech artificial music from the 1960s to the present to discover new technical possibilities of percussion instruments and then apply them to the musical process. The work contains several notes about the historical re-evaluation of the percussion instruments in the hands of the composers, and the emancipation of the percussion instruments in the work of Czech composers. The work contains several theoretical and interpretative analyzes, namely the analysis of works by Miloslav Kabeláč, Marek Kopelent and Daniel Chudovský. The aim of the work is to point out the increasing demands for interpretation of contemporary music for percussion instruments, but also the resonant plurality and openness of various composing personalities of the selected time period.

Timpani technique by Fred D. Hinger
Zhdanovich, Anton ; MIKOLÁŠEK, Daniel (advisor) ; Holub, Petr (referee)
This bachelor thesis focuses on contemporary problems of primarily orchestral timpani playing. In this thesis, I tried to explain, why a timpani player is often unable to reach the desired quality of sound and tone of the instrument, which make it impossible to reach the right musical character in the context of that particular musical piece. The goal of this work is to enrich the Czech school of timpani playing and to contribute to the growth of interpretation abilities of beginning and intermediate timpani players. Another goal is to show a different tradition of kettledrum playing with all its details. I focused on the practical side of the instrument playing and I describe the methods and the process of solving technical and musical problems of interpreters in this paper. The character of this thesis is completely practical and focuses on the description of one of the many other world traditions of timpani playing.
